Does Freedomland have end credit scenes?
No!
Freedomland does not have end credit scenes. You can leave when the credits roll.

Brenda Martin, portrayed by Julianne Moore, is a dedicated single mother making ends meet while working at a day care center located in the Armstrong housing project of Dempsy, New Jersey. Though she resides in the small blue-collar town of Gannon, which enjoys a more favorable reputation than Dempsy, her world is turned upside down one fateful night.
After experiencing a traumatic event, she arrives at the hospital covered in blood, prompting the Dempsy Police, including Detective Lorenzo Council, played by Samuel L. Jackson, to investigate. Brenda claims she was carjacked and assaulted by a black man, igniting tensions between the two communities. Amid growing concerns, she reveals a devastating truth: her four-year-old son, Cody, was asleep in the backseat during the incident. This revelation sparks a frantic search for the child, exposing the underlying racial discord and complicating Brenda’s truth as the investigation unfolds.
As the case progresses, Brenda’s emotional stability deteriorates. Her past as a former drug addict surfaces, raising suspicions among the police about her credibility. When her brother, Danny Martin, arrives at the hospital, the tension heightens as he presents a photo of Cody, further emphasizing the stakes. Lorenzo, aware of the volatile situation, reflects on the challenge of leading the investigation under intense scrutiny from his colleagues, who question his ability given his health issues and personal struggles.
In the midst of chaos and heightened emotions, Brenda becomes increasingly unpredictable, leading to dramatic moments where she lashes out in frustration and confusion. While Lorenzo diligently follows leads, another cop’s pointed accusations regarding Brenda’s character cast doubt on her honesty. The investigation leads them to explore various areas, including the now-abandoned Freedomland, where they hope to discover clues about Cody’s whereabouts.
As the community rallies to search for the missing child, Brenda remains caught in a spiral of grief and anxiety, repeatedly struggling to recount the events of that evening without drawing suspicion. Meanwhile, the tension continues to escalate, with the media capturing every moment as outrage builds within the community, resulting in violent protests and chaotic confrontations between residents and the police.
Ultimately, Brenda’s fate is sealed when a body is discovered in the woods, and the investigation takes a harrowing turn. It becomes evident that the tragic outcome of this case reaches far beyond a simple missing child; it ignites a fierce debate on race, responsibility, and the very fabric of community connections. Detective Lorenzo must navigate these turbulent waters, striving to find justice for Cody while wrestling with his own emotional turmoil and the implications of the case.
“A mother always knows,” Brenda asserts, betraying her innermost fears and the heartbreaking reality of loss. The story of Brenda and Cody Martin, intertwined with the lives of those in their community, evolves into a powerful narrative of maternal love, societal strife, and the quest for truth in the darkest hours.
